But let us speak in order, characteristics from e-bike or electric bicycle.
European regulations set clear limits for the electric bicycle, EU standart pedelecmax. speed 25 km/h, max. power 250 W, assisted pedalling and not fully electric, i.e. the action of the motor must be combined with a slight movement of the legs.
These are the European standards that the law imposes on us, let's see what features we can choose from instead.
Motor positioning
can be on the front or rear wheel, much rarer, the centre position. Although the central location certainly has its advantages, for example to change a wheel where the motor is located you do not first have to disconnect the motor cable, as with the other two solutions. The biggest disadvantage of central positioning is that the bicycle frame must be prepared for the motor and therefore it is not possible to mount the motor after it leaves the factory; it is also the most expensive solution.
Positioning in the front wheel is the simplest solution in terms of assembly, but also the most inadvisable as it can create some difficulty in riding the bike due to both the imbalance in weight distribution and the change in traction, which is naturally at the rear of the bike. In addition, in the event of rain, there is a risk of losing grip when riding uphill or on dirt roads.
In our opinion the rear position is the most effective and practical, it is slightly more complicated in the initial assembly, but the only real disadvantage is having to disconnect the cable before changing the wheel. In terms of performance, however, it is definitely the best solution.
Battery
is the most important component of the entire electrical kit, the best are at lithium while lead-gel and nickel-metal hydride also exist. OK, fine, but why are lithium batteries considered the best compared to the other 2 solutions? Simple! They are much lighter, quicker to charge, do not pollute and do not require maintenance during temperatures below - 5°C and above + 30°C, so up to - 20°C and up to + 50° we can be comfortable; considering climate change and if we don't do our own (e.g. prefer the bike to the car where and when possible) for about another 5 years.
Capacity
measured in Watt-hours, Wh indicates the energy delivered to the motor and is calculated by multiplying the voltage, V, by the current intensity per hour, Ah. Below 360 Wh it is considered low, above 450 Wh high.
Autonomy
very difficult to calculate as it depends on many factors including the weight of the bike, rider and load, gradient, type of terrain and level of assistance. It also changes as the battery ages, the life of which lasts about three years. Thus, under 50 km is considered low, from 50 to 80 km medium and from 80 to high.
The efficiency of the’pedalling assistance depends on the number of levels, below 3 is low, above 5 high.
On-board computer
allows you to choose the level of assistance and state of charge, in more expensive versions they may also have a km counter, power setting, integrated GPS, etc...
Often there are hybrid solutions that combine the on-board computer with an app to download. In this case, the presence of a mobile phone holder on the handlebar is important.

The size of the wheels
affects not only the compactness but also the comfort and speed of the bike: the larger the wheels, the more comfortable and faster the bike (applying the same effort), while the smaller the wheels, the more compact the bike will be when folded. As they say, you need a compromise between compactness, comfort and speed. Wheel size is most often measured in inches and can vary from 12” to 29”, the classic city bike has 28” wheels. In order to choose the right one for one's needs, one must therefore ask oneself the length of the route to be covered and how often one will need to close the bike. Obviously, if one intends to commute by car and cycle a short distance, several times a day, a bicycle with small wheels and vice versa is more appropriate.
